Fachhochschule Kufstein Tirol is highly pleased to announce the offer of a 12-month postdoctoral position in the field of Computational Imaging and cryo-electron tomography, starting with immediate effect. The position is part of a research project in collaboration with Biohub. The goal of the project is to develop computational methods for deformation-aware reconstruction in cryo-ET. The focus lies on modeling and correcting local, non-rigid deformations in tilt-series data, in particular using compact differentiable representations such as Gaussian primitives, Gaussian Splatting, or related approaches. Postdoc Position in Computational Imaging / Cryo-ET Reconstruction (w/m/d) Ref.Nr.: 06-26 | earliest | Full time | 1 year limitation Responsibilities Modeling deformation fields using Gaussian primitives / Gaussian Splatting or related representations Integrating deformation models into reconstruction and alignment methods Implementing efficient, differentiable algorithms in Python with PyTorch Evaluation on simulated and experimental cryo-ET data Documentation of results and preparation of scientific publications Candidate Profile Completed PhD in Computational Imaging, Computer Vision, Computer Science, Applied Mathematics, or a related field Excellent programming skills in Python with PyTorch Experience in the following areas: Gaussian Splatting or parametric 3D representations; 3D reconstruction; Cryo-EM / cryo-ET; Inverse problems and self-supervised learning Ability to conduct independent scientific work Excellent English skills The Project Offers A challenging postdoctoral position at the interface of Computational Imaging, inverse problems and cryo-ET Participation in an international research project in collaboration with Biohub The opportunity to develop novel methods for modern biological imaging and data from state-of-the-art microscopes The opportunity to publish and present the scientific results of the project In addition to a gross salary of EUR 65.000,00 per annum (salary is depending on qualifications, experience and individual skills), we offer an attractive incentive programme, a wide range of training and development opportunities, and the option to work remotely for a substantial proportion of the time (40%).
